as far as FI goes guys, You would be safe to go with single or twin turbo on a stock motor if you want 350-400whp like soleil said. You can successfully run up to 430-450whp if you get a custom tune by someone that really know what they are doing. After that tune, don't fuq with it. Now that's not meaning you can constantly go running around boosting up on your tune and staying at the 450whp range. Normal driving, you can stay on low boost and run around the 350-380 range. You will be fine. If you stay in the higher range, you will be pushing the envelope and of course the life of the motor will be shortened. I know a little about FI but I really am no guru when it comes to FI so don't quote me for 100% truth. The things I am writing are information I pick up reading through the FI section.
